Cyrinda Foxe (February 22, 1952 – September 7, 2002) was an American actress, model and publicist, best known for her role in Andy Warhol's Bad. She was married to both David Johansen, of the New York Dolls, and Steven Tyler, of the rock band Aerosmith.

Early life and career

Foxe was born Katheleen Victoria Hetzekian in Santa Monica, California, to an Armenian family. She grew up as an army brat in an abusive household. After graduating high school, she lived in Texas briefly before settling in New York City, where she got a job working as an assistant to Greta Garbo. She later changed her name and began frequenting Max's Kansas City, the famous nightclub, and became an actress. She's best known for her role in Andy Warhol's Bad (1977). Foxe had an affair with David Bowie, while working as a publicist for MainMan Artistes LTD, Bowie's management company. She also appeared in the music video for Bowie's 1972 single, "The Jean Genie".

Foxe grew up idolizing the Rolling Stones. She later became involved with the New York Dolls, a protopunk band often compared to the Stones. In 1977, after years of dating, Cyrinda married David Johansen, the singer for the New York Dolls. At the time, the New York Dolls had the same management as Aerosmith, and while Foxe was involved with Johansen, she met Aerosmith's lead singer Steven Tyler.

After less than a year of marriage to Johansen, Foxe left him for Steven Tyler. Foxe and Tyler married and had a daughter, Mia, but the marriage was troubled by drug addiction, extramarital affairs, and physical and emotional abuse. Foxe and Tyler divorced shortly before Aerosmith made a comeback in the late 1980s. She raised Mia in Sunapee, New Hampshire and New York City.

Later years and death

In 1997, Foxe's memoir, Dream On: Livin' on the Edge with Steven Tyler and Aerosmith,[1] co-written with Danny Fields, was published. As anticipated, it received mostly negative reactions from Aerosmith fans. Not long after the book was released, Foxe announced that the paperback edition of Dream On would include nude photos of Steven Tyler. But in 1999, Tyler won a lawsuit against Foxe, preventing her from publishing the photos. In 2000, she launched a web site in which she was selling nude pictures of Tyler, but by the end of the year, the site closed for undisclosed reasons.

In 2001, Foxe had a mild stroke. She received Medicare and food stamps as she had no apartment or place to live. Myra Freidman organized a benefit at CBGB to raise money for Foxe. Embarrassed by Foxe's poverty, Steven Tyler met with her and their daughter Mia at Balthazar, later donating a signed Aerosmith guitar to the benefit, which sold for $5000. David Bowie also donated an acoustic guitar. Tyler agreed to pay for a room for Cyrinda at the Gramercy Park Hotel where on August 28, 2002, she married Keith Waa.

Foxe died from an inoperable brain tumor on September 7, 2002.
